PIMEDPI FindOrLoadImeDpi(
    HKL hKL)
{
    PIMEDPI        pImeDpi, pTmpImeDpi;
    IMEINFOEX      iiex;

    /*
     * Non IME based keyboard layout doesn't have IMEDPI.
     */
    if (!IS_IME_KBDLAYOUT(hKL))
        return (PIMEDPI)NULL;

    pImeDpi = ImmLockImeDpi(hKL);

    if (pImeDpi == NULL) {
        /*
         * This process hasn't load up the specified IME based layout.
         * Query the IME information and load it up now.
         */
        if (!ImmGetImeInfoEx(&iiex, ImeInfoExKeyboardLayout, &hKL)) {
            RIPMSG1(RIP_WARNING,
                  "FindOrLoadImeDpi: ImmGetImeInfoEx(%lx) failed", hKL);
            return NULL;
        }

        /*
         * Win95 behaviour: If there was an IME load error for this layout,
         * further attempt to load the same IME layout will be rejected.
         */
        if (iiex.fLoadFlag == IMEF_LOADERROR)
            return NULL;

        /*
         * Allocate a new IMEDPI for this layout.
         */
        pImeDpi = (PIMEDPI)ImmLocalAlloc(HEAP_ZERO_MEMORY, sizeof(IMEDPI));
        if (pImeDpi == NULL)
            return NULL;

        if (!LoadIME(&iiex, pImeDpi)) {
            LocalFree(pImeDpi);
            return NULL;
        }

        pImeDpi->hKL = hKL;
        pImeDpi->cLock++;

        /*
         * Link in the newly allocated entry.
         */
        RtlEnterCriticalSection(&gcsImeDpi);

        /*
         * Serach the gpImeDpi list again and discard this
         * pImeDpi if other thread has updated the list for
         * the same layout while we leave the critical section.
         */
        pTmpImeDpi = ImmLockImeDpi(hKL);

        if (pTmpImeDpi == NULL) {
            /*
             * Update the global list for this new pImeDpi entry.
             */
            pImeDpi->pNext = gpImeDpi;
            gpImeDpi = pImeDpi;
            RtlLeaveCriticalSection(&gcsImeDpi);
        }
        else {
            /*
             * The same IME has been loaded, discard this extra entry.
             */
            RtlLeaveCriticalSection(&gcsImeDpi);
            UnloadIME(pImeDpi, FALSE);
            ImmLocalFree(pImeDpi);
            pImeDpi = pTmpImeDpi;
        }
    }

    return pImeDpi;
}
